summary refs log tree commit diff
path: root/pkgs/applications/audio
diff options
context:
space:
mode:
authorThomas Churchman <thomas@kepow.org>2020-09-25 23:35:01 +0300
committerThomas Churchman <thomas@kepow.org>2020-09-25 23:35:01 +0300
commite2c342ad381a1904ed10bdcf5d8325a57bea0166 (patch)
tree4481658563c679f24491f3b6686316806c81c593 /pkgs/applications/audio
parent25f78a8cfede6e309709ed090704fb012be3f062 (diff)
downloadnix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ar.gz
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ar.bz2
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ar.lz
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ar.xz
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.tar.zst
nixpkgs-e2c342ad381a1904ed10bdcf5d8325a57bea0166.zip
renoise: patch audio plugin server
Diffstat (limited to 'pkgs/applications/audio')
-rw-r--r--pkgs/applications/audio/renoise/default.nix9
1 files changed, 7 insertions, 2 deletions
diff --git a/pkgs/applications/audio/renoise/default.nix b/pkgs/applications/audio/renoise/default.nix
index 0ae65cb8c37..c01d57459f8 100644
--- a/pkgs/applications/audio/renoise/default.nix
+++ b/pkgs/applications/audio/renoise/default.nix
@@ -37,8 +37,6 @@ stdenv.mkDerivation rec {
 
     mkdir -p $out/lib/
 
-    mv $out/AudioPluginServer* $out/lib/
-
     cp renoise $out/renoise
 
     for path in ${toString buildInputs}; do
@@ -56,6 +54,13 @@ stdenv.mkDerivation rec {
       --set-interpreter $(cat $NIX_CC/nix-support/dynamic-linker) \
       --set-rpath ${mpg123}/lib:$out/lib \
       $out/renoise
+
+    for path in $out/AudioPluginServer*; do
+      patchelf \
+        --set-interpreter $(cat $NIX_CC/nix-support/dynamic-linker) \
+        --set-rpath $out/lib \
+        $path
+    done
   '';
 
   meta = {